Side-by-Side Comparison

Feature mandaba mandala
Definition Primera persona del singular (yo) del pretérito imperfecto de indicativo de mandar o de mandarse. Símbolo compuesto de figuras y patrones concéntricos que representan la naturaleza repetitiva del universo y de la naturaleza.

Why the eye confuses mandaba with mandala

These two trip readers on the page rather than in the ear: mandaba is [mãn̪ˈd̪aβ̞a] while mandala is [mãn̪ˈd̪ala]. Spoken aloud the problem disappears. In writing it persists, because they differ by a single letter - b in “mandaba” becomes l in “mandala”, and the parts of speech differ too (verb vs noun), which is usually the fastest check.
